Summary

The TLC696xx-Q1 family has the CLK_O duty cycle increase behavior under 3.3V I/O voltage, so the minimum clock low time limits the maximum cascaded LED drivers. TLC69699-Q1 can help decrease the required CCSI frequency with CCSI duty cycle control, optimized fault-readback scheme, and TXFIFO features, which allows more cascaded TLC696xx-Q1 drivers in a single long daisy chain.
